BSU Department of Music Admission Standards:
All incoming and transfer students must perform an audition for the music faculty and take the Music Literacy Predictive Exam. Auditions and exams will take place beginning with the first audition day in Spring Semester. Students who a) perform an acceptable performance audition, and b) complete the Music Literacy Exam will be granted Music Major status. All other students will be given Pre-Music Major status. Only Pre-Music Major and Music Major status students will be allowed to enroll in Materials of Music I.
